Unconditioned Stimulus
In classical conditioning, it is a stimulus that naturally and automatically triggers a response without any prior learning.
Conditioned Response
A learned reaction to a previously neutral stimulus that has been repeatedly paired with an unconditioned stimulus causing an automatic response.
Taste Aversions
A learned response to eating spoiled or toxic food, resulting in an aversion to the taste of foods associated with illness or poor experiences.
Insight Learning
A cognitive process in which a problem is suddenly understood or solved through an "aha" moment without trial-and-error behavior.
